    Takes a while, but the secret is patience. If you pull all three giants at once they will stomp you. Pull the lower level giants individually. Focus on killing adds while slowly whittling down the giant. Pull the big guy after you've killed the smaller giants. Win. Pretty basic boss strat. If the tank rushes in to grab all 3 giants, just hang back and let him die... He will learn.

    For the final phase with 3 giants up,

    Tip 1: this skirmish is much easier with one or more CW.
    Tip 2: the CW(s) can kill the giants from a distance through the "door".
    Tip 3: the boss is not immune to CC.

    If any adds come through the door, the rest of the group can just burn them down.

    Alternatively, if you have a pro healer, high dps and one good CW for the adds, you can just burn all the giants down in melee range. But this is not a typical pug.
